“Summers Coming”
By Sarah
May 10, 2010
My 9th grade year of school is coming to an end
I don’t know if I should be glad or sad
I have made so many new friends
I don’t know if I’m ready to leave them for many months
I have learned so much
When it comes to my self
And other emotions and games
I am ready for being the night owl I was born to be
But I’ll miss hanging out with my crushes
The arms that wrap around me in a hug
All of the talking and laughing
I will not miss my stalker of an ex
But so many things out weigh that annoyance
My ex friend has been quite an experience
But I have met so many people besides her
Got in touch with an buddy
And realized guys can only be friends and be fine with it
Schools almost out for the summer
Sounds fun going to California
But what about the courtyard which is now so familiar
The teachers who I have grown to liking
What will my sophomore year bring?
More drama? Harder classes? More jerks?
I have no clue
I hope I can get my confidence up
So when I enter the doors again
I can hold my head up high and
Concur my nerve-racking fears
Who knows?
I’m ready for summer and to leave something’s behind
Also ready to look ahead at a brand new school year
